Why whole home water filtration matters in Malibu, CA

Malibu’s coastal environment and nearby Santa Monica Mountains create specific water challenges:

  1. Salt corrosion risk from ocean spray that accelerates plumbing and appliance wear on exposed pipe runs and exterior fixtures.
  2. Taste and odor issues due to chlorine or chloramine used in municipal treatment, especially noticeable in coastal homes with sensitive palates.
  3. Post-storm sediment and turbidity when runoff carries soils and organic material into the municipal supply or private wells.
  4. Wildfire ash and contamination following regional fires can introduce ash, metals, and organic contaminants to local sources.
  5. Hard water scaling in many parts of the region leads to reduced appliance efficiency and mineral buildup on fixtures.

A properly designed whole home water filtration Malibu, CA system addresses these regional factors at the source, protecting the entire plumbing network and improving daily water quality.

Common whole home filtration types and what they treat

  1. Sediment Filters (polypleated/pleated cartridges, spin-down): Removes sand, silt, rust, and large particles that cause cloudy water and abrasive wear on fixtures. Typical first stage in multi-stage systems.
  2. Granular Activated Carbon (GAC) and Catalytic Carbon: Reduces chlorine, chloramine (with catalytic), volatile organic compounds (VOCs), pesticides, and improves taste and odor.
  3. KDF Media (copper-zinc alloy): Controls scale, reduces chlorine and some heavy metals, and inhibits bacterial growth in carbon beds.
  4. Backwashing Multi-Media Filters: Designed for high sediment loads and turbidity control; useful after storms or if source water is variable.
  5. Ion Exchange Water Softeners: Remove hardness (calcium and magnesium) to prevent scale; often paired with filtration for full protection.
  6. Specialty Media (iron/manganese, arsenic, sulfur): Targeted media remove iron staining, sulfur smell, or select heavy metals common in some well water sources.
  7. UV Disinfection (point-of-entry or point-of-use): Kills bacteria and viruses when biological contamination is a concern. Usually paired with pre-filtration.
  8. Whole Home Reverse Osmosis: Rare as a point-of-entry due to waste and flow limits; most homeowners use whole home filters for general protection and a separate under-sink RO for drinking water.

Typical contaminants addressed in Malibu homes

  1. Chlorine and chloramine (taste and odor)
  2. Sediment, sand, and turbidity
  3. Hardness minerals (calcium, magnesium)
  4. Iron and manganese (staining)
  5. Sulfur/hydrogen sulfide (rotten egg odor) in private wells
  6. Pesticides, herbicides, and VOC traces
  7. Wildfire-related ash, organics, and occasional heavy metals in runoff-impacted supplies

How we evaluate and size a whole home system

  1. Comprehensive water testing: Identify chlorine/chloramine levels, hardness, TDS, iron, pH, and any site-specific contaminants like sulfur or arsenic.
  2. Flow rate and household demand calculation: Whole home systems must support peak flow (shower plus appliances). Typical sizing for Malibu homes ranges from 10 to 25 gallons per minute depending on home size and irrigation demands.
  3. System selection: Based on test results: multi-stage setups combining sediment pre-filter, catalytic carbon for chloramines, KDF for metal reduction, and a softener or specialty media where needed.
  4. Material selection for coastal durability: Corrosion-resistant fittings and housings to withstand salt air and humid coastal conditions.

Installation requirements and considerations

  1. Point-of-entry placement: Usually in the garage, utility room, or near the main shutoff where the main water line enters. For hillside Malibu homes, access and elevation must be evaluated.
  2. Space and clearance: Most systems require room for tanks, backwashing lines, and access for filter changes.
  3. Plumbing modifications: Shutoff valves, bypass loops for maintenance, pressure regulators, and pressure relief may be needed.
  4. Electrical supply: Backwashing systems, electronic controllers, and UV units require a dedicated outlet with proper protection.
  5. Permits and codes: Local plumbing codes and water reclamation rules may apply, especially for irrigation or dual-plumbed systems.
  6. Seismic and weatherproofing: Secure mounting and freeze protection for exposed equipment in elevated coastal microclimates.

Maintenance expectations

  1. Routine cartridge replacements: Sediment cartridges: typically every 3 to 12 months depending on load. Carbon cartridges: every 6 to 12 months for drinking quality benefits. Follow manufacturer specs.
  2. Backwashing schedule: Automatic for backwashing multimedia filters; frequency depends on turbidity and sediment load.
  3. Annual inspection: Test system performance, check seals, controllers, and replace worn parts. Re-test water after major events like storms or wildfire activity.
  4. Softener resin and salt checks: Resin life often several years; salt replenishment varies by household use.
  5. UV lamp replacement: Usually annually even if lamp still lights, to maintain guaranteed disinfection.

Measurable improvements you can expect

  1. Improved taste and odor at all faucets and showers by reducing chlorine and organics.
  2. Cleaner showers and fixtures with less film and spotting due to reduced chlorine and sediment.
  3. Longer appliance life and fewer repairs for water heaters, dishwashers, and ice makers by preventing scale and sediment damage.
  4. Softer laundry and easier cleaning when hardness is reduced, with less detergent required and brighter fabrics.
  5. Reduced staining and cloudy glassware from iron and manganese control.
  6. Peace of mind knowing water entering your home is treated before it reaches any plumbing or appliances.

Common Malibu problems and filters that solve them

  1. Cloudy water after heavy rain: backwashing sediment filter plus pre-filter cartridge
  2. Strong chlorine or chemical taste: catalytic carbon stage optimized for chloramine reduction
  3. Scale on showerheads and fixtures: ion exchange softener or template-assisted crystallization for scale control
  4. Sulfur smell in well homes: oxidizing media (manganese greensand or catalytic carbon) and aeration options
  5. Corrosion of outdoor spigots: whole home filtration reducing corrosive chloramines and using corrosion-resistant fittings
